What are the main differences between electric ranges and induction cooktops? induction cooktops feature a copper coil that conducts electromagnetic energy, while electric cooktops have a metal coil that heats up via electricity running through them. both offer power, precision and performance when delivering fast cooktop heat and superb heat control. The induction cooktop only heats the cookware, while an electric cooktop heats the surface of the cooktop. while electric and induction cooktops look very similar, they offer a very different cooking experience, with induction cooking providing an alternative heating technology that will affect. consumer reports' experts parse out whether an induction or an electric cooktop is the right choice for you based on your budget and your household. if speed, energy efficiency, and precise temperature control are paramount, an induction range is the clear frontrunner.
